SDK支付:提升移动支付体验的利器

随着移动互联网的普及和智能手机的普遍应用,移动支付已成为现代生活中不可或缺的一部分。无论是购物、餐饮、打车还是转账,支付的便捷性和安全性至关重要。在这一过程中,SDK(软件开发工具包)支付作为一种高效且灵活的支付解决方案,正在逐渐被开发者和商家所接受。本文将详细探讨SDK支付的定义、优势、应用场景及其发展趋势。 一、SDK支付的定义 SDK支付是指通过集成支付SDK(Software Development Kit,软件开发工具包)实现移动支付功能的一种方式。SDK支付通过提供一整套的支付接口、开发文档和示例代码,帮助开发者快速地将支付功能集成到自己的应用程序中。SDK一般由支付平台提供,开发者通过下载、配置和调用SDK中的相关接口,就可以实现支付功能的接入,而不需要重新开发支付系统。 二、SDK支付的优势 1. **简化开发过程** SDK支付最大的优势就是能够大大简化开发过程。开发者不需要从零开始设计支付系统,只需利用支付平台提供的SDK进行集成,节省了开发时间和精力。这对于初创企业和小型开发团队尤为重要,能够让他们专注于业务的其他方面。 2. **高度的兼容性** 现代的支付SDK通常具备高度的兼容性,可以支持不同操作系统(如Android、iOS)和不同支付渠道(如支付宝、微信支付、银行卡支付等)。开发者无需担心多平台、多支付方式的问题,SDK可以帮助他们轻松实现支付功能的跨平台兼容。 3. **安全性保障** 支付SDK由专业的支付平台提供,这些平台通常会投入大量资源确保支付的安全性。例如,支付SDK通常会内置安全协议(如SSL加密、RSA加密等),以保证用户交易信息的安全。此外,支付平台还会定期进行安全性更新和漏洞修复,进一步提升支付系统的安全性。 4. **丰富的功能支持** 除了基础的支付功能外,许多支付SDK还提供了丰富的附加功能,如支付统计分析、退款处理、订单查询等。这些功能可以帮助商家更好地管理支付流程,提升用户体验。 5. **降低成本** 与自主开发支付系统相比,集成现有支付SDK不仅节省了开发成本,还能够避免因支付系统出现故障导致的业务损失。商家和开发者可以通过SDK支付将更多的资源集中到核心业务上,提升整体运营效率。 三、SDK支付的应用场景 SDK支付的应用场景非常广泛,几乎涵盖了所有需要支付功能的移动应用程序。 1. **电商平台** 电商平台是SDK支付最常见的应用场景之一。通过集成支付SDK,电商平台可以为用户提供便捷的支付方式,从而提升交易成功率。例如,用户在购物过程中可以选择支付宝、微信支付等多种支付方式,支付过程快捷、安全,极大地提升了用户体验。 2. **O2O业务** O2O(Online to Offline,线上到线下)业务是SDK支付的另一大应用领域。许多O2O平台通过集成支付SDK来实现线上支付。例如,用户可以在打车、订餐或预约服务时使用SDK支付完成交易,而无需跳转到其他支付应用或页面。 3. **游戏和娱乐应用** 在移动游戏和娱乐应用中,SDK支付同样扮演着至关重要的角色。通过集成支付SDK,开发者可以为玩家提供内购功能,方便他们购买虚拟道具、订阅会员等。例如,许多手游都提供内购功能,玩家可以直接通过微信、支付宝等支付方式购买游戏道具或点券。 4. **金融科技** SDK支付在金融科技领域也有广泛的应用,尤其是在数字钱包、借贷平台和P2P支付等领域。支付SDK可以帮助金融机构和创业公司快速构建支付系统,简化支付过程,提升用户体验。 5. **公益和捐赠平台** 越来越多的公益和捐赠平台开始采用SDK支付,以便让用户轻松地进行捐款。通过支付SDK,平台可以提供多种支付方式,帮助用户在几分钟内完成捐款,增加平台的资金流动性和用户参与度。 四、SDK支付的发展趋势 随着科技的进步和用户需求的变化,SDK支付也在不断发展,未来可能会呈现出以下几个趋势: 1. **多元化支付方式的整合** 随着支付方式的不断增加,SDK支付将继续向多元化发展。未来的SDK可能会支持更多支付渠道,如虚拟货币支付、二维码支付、指纹支付等,进一步满足用户多样化的支付需求。 2. **人工智能与区块链技术的结合** 人工智能和区块链技术的发展也为SDK支付带来了新的可能性。未来,SDK支付可能会结合人工智能技术进行风控管理,提升支付的安全性和效率。而区块链技术则可能用于支付过程中的信息存证,确保支付过程的透明性和不可篡改性。 3. **全球化支付支持** 随着跨境电商和国际业务的发展,SDK支付将更加注重全球化的支付支持。未来的SDK可能会支持更多国家和地区的支付方式,帮助商家和开发者更好地进入国际市场。 4. **增强的用户体验** 随着竞争的加剧,SDK支付将更加注重提升用户体验。未来,支付SDK可能会提供更智能的支付方式,如无感支付、语音支付等,让支付过程更加便捷流畅。 五、总结 SDK支付作为一种高效、便捷、安全的支付方式,正在为各行各业的移动应用程序提供支持。它不仅降低了开发难度和成本,还能为商家提供丰富的支付功能和安全保障。随着技术的不断发展,SDK支付的应用场景将进一步扩展,支付方式也将更加多样化。在未来,SDK支付将继续扮演着推动移动支付发展的重要角色,成为推动数字经济发展的核心力量之一。